PG Diploma in Information Technology (Post Graduate Diploma in Information Technology)
PG. Diploma in Information Technology About
Post Graduate Diploma in Information Technology (PGDIT) is a one-year diploma course that covers the various aspects of computer science, including programming, database management, software development, web development, network management, and cybersecurity. PG. Diploma in Information Technology Syllabus
| SEMESTER I | SEMESTER II |
| Principles and Practices of Management | Business Requirement Analysis |
| Business Communication | Project Management (IT) |
| Information Technology Concepts | Business Applications and ERP |
| Database Management Systems | Software Engineering with UML |
| Algorithms and Programming Concepts | Current Trends in IT |
| Software Quality Management | Business Process Modelling |
| Data Warehousing and Data Mining | Cloud Computing |
| E-Business | Project |
| Information Security Management | - |
| Software Documentation | - |
